Store refrigerated foods in covered containers or sealed storage bags and check leftovers daily for spoilage. Freeze food at 0 F or lower. You can freeze your items flat in gallon or quart-sized bags.
Add only the amount that will freeze within 24 hours. The maximum amount of food your freezer is designed to freeze at one time is approximately 3 pounds 15 kg per cubic foot of freezer capacity. Freeze foods as soon as they are packaged and sealed.

Dont overload your freezer. To facilitate more rapid freezing set the freezer at minus 10 F about 24 hours in advance of adding unfrozen foods. Store eggs in their carton in the refrigerator itself rather than on the door where.
For bottom-compartment and chest freezers repurpose open desktop file boxes for slim boxes like frozen pizzas. Per cubic foot Place packages in contact with the coldest part of the freezer. Do not overload the freezer with unfrozen food.
